*Description*
Position Summary: We are seeking a proactive and technically skilled Field Technician to support a large-scale label printer deployment as part of the Epic Beaker rollout, which underpins critical lab workflows across hospital departments. This role will also provide hands-on support for a variety of end-user devices including laptops, desktops, and peripheral hardware. Key Responsibilities: *Install, configure, and validate label printers across multiple lab and clinical environments. *Troubleshoot hardware and connectivity issues, escalating complex problems to appropriate teams. *Support additional end-user devices (e.g., laptops, desktops, other printers) as needed. *Maintain accurate documentation of deployments, configurations, and inventory. *Track and report on deployment progress, replacements, and upgrades across departments and facilities. *Collaborate with IT, clinical, and project stakeholders to ensure seamless integration and minimal disruption to lab operations. *Adhere to hospital safety and compliance standards during all on-site activities. *Physically capable of lifting up to 50 lbs and working on foot for extended periods. *Skills* Desktop, Troubleshooting, Support, Customer service, label printing software, printer hardware, epic systems *Top Skills Details* Desktop,Troubleshooting,Support,Customer service,label printing software,printer hardware *Additional Skills & Qualifications* Experience with label printer hardware (e.g., Zebra, DYMO) and configuration in healthcare or enterprise environments. Familiarity with Epic Beaker or other LIS (Laboratory Information Systems) is a strong plus. Working knowledge of Windows OS, device imaging, and basic networking. Excellent communication and documentation skills. Ability to work independently and manage time effectively in a fast-paced, clinical setting. *Experience Level* Entry Level *Pay and Benefits* The pay range for this position is $20.00 - $25.00/hr.
